1. Testosterone: Total AND Free — Why Both Numbers Matter
Most blood tests check total testosterone, which measures the entire amount of the hormone circulating in your blood. But here’s the catch: proteins — primarily sex hormone-binding globulin (SHBG) — bind to a significant portion of that testosterone, locking it away so your body cannot actually use it.
Free testosterone is the unbound, active fraction your cells can work with directly. This is what drives libido, erection quality, energy levels, and muscle repair. When free testosterone is low, you feel it — even if your total testosterone looks fine on paper.
Research published in the Journal of Sexual Medicine found that men with normal total testosterone but low calculated free testosterone showed significantly worse scores on erectile function, sexual desire, and orgasmic function compared to men with normal levels of both — confirming that free testosterone is the more clinically relevant marker for sexual symptoms.
A separate PubMed study found that total testosterone alone misdiagnosed hypogonadism in more than 8% of men presenting with sexual symptoms, and that free testosterone provides a more accurate diagnosis of functional hypogonadism, particularly in men over 45 where SHBG naturally rises with age.
What this means for you: If you’ve been told your testosterone is “normal” but you’re still experiencing poor erections, fatigue, or low drive, ask specifically for free testosterone to be included. It’s the number that matters most for how you feel and function day to day.

2. Estradiol (E2) — The Hormone Men Forget About
Most men are surprised to learn they need to test estrogen. Estradiol (E2) is the predominant form of oestrogen, and while most people associate it with female physiology, it plays an essential and well-documented role in male sexual function.
Your body produces estradiol through a process called aromatisation — an enzyme called aromatase converts a portion of your testosterone into estrogen. This is completely normal and necessary. The problem arises when the balance shifts too far in either direction.
A comprehensive review published in Asian Journal of Andrology confirmed that estradiol in men is essential for modulating libido, erectile function, and spermatogenesis, with estrogen receptors found throughout the brain, penis, and testes. Crucially, the same research noted that both low testosterone and elevated estrogen increase the incidence of erectile dysfunction independently of one another — meaning either extreme causes problems.
Signs your E2 may be too low:
- Flat, low mood
- Joint discomfort
- Reduced libido
- Poor erection quality
Signs your E2 may be too high:
- Water retention
- Fatigue and emotional shifts
- Softer erections
- Reduced drive despite adequate testosterone
A meta-analysis in PLOS ONE confirmed that elevated estradiol levels are significantly associated with erectile dysfunction, supporting the clinical importance of monitoring this marker, particularly for men on testosterone therapy where aromatisation can increase.
The practical takeaway: erections depend on hormonal balance, not just testosterone levels in isolation. Estradiol is part of that balance, and it’s rarely included in a basic hormone panel. Ask for it by name.
3. PSA (Prostate-Specific Antigen) — A Marker You Should Track, Not Fear
PSA is a protein the prostate gland produces. Most people associate it with prostate cancer screening, but its clinical value extends well beyond that — it’s a useful general indicator of prostate health, including inflammation and benign enlargement (BPH).
For men over 55, and especially for those who are on or considering testosterone replacement therapy (TRT), PSA monitoring is non-negotiable. Testosterone can stimulate prostate tissue activity, which means that without appropriate oversight, it can amplify any pre-existing prostate changes.
What you’re looking for isn’t necessarily a low number — it’s a stable, non-rising number over time. Tracking PSA as a trend over months and years gives you far more insight than a single reading taken out of context. A sudden or steady rise warrants investigation — but it doesn’t automatically indicate cancer.

4. Hematocrit — The Blood Thickness Number Nobody Talks About
Hematocrit measures the proportion of red blood cells in your blood. The higher the hematocrit, the thicker your blood. And while this might sound like a minor detail, it has direct implications for circulation, blood pressure, and — yes — erectile function.
Testosterone stimulates red blood cell production. This is one of the reasons TRT can be effective for energy and endurance. But without monitoring, it can quietly push your hematocrit too high over time, creating a paradox: the very hormone you’re optimising for sexual performance can begin to impair circulation if blood thickness goes unchecked.
High hematocrit increases the risk of clotting, raises blood pressure, and can reduce the free-flowing circulation that healthy erections depend on. Men on TRT should check hematocrit at baseline and regularly thereafter — most guidelines recommend monitoring every three to six months.
This marker is especially important if you’ve noticed that treatments or supplementation aren’t delivering the results you expected. Why All Four Markers Must Be Reviewed Together
Each of these four markers tells part of the story. But the real insight comes from reading them as a system.
Think of it like four components of an engine. Testosterone drives the core performance. Estradiol calibrates the balance. PSA tells you the prostate is safe to accelerate. Hematocrit determines whether the fuel is flowing cleanly.
If testosterone is high but estradiol is elevated, erection quality suffers. Creeping hematocrit will compromise circulation even when testosterone sits at an optimal level. Rising PSA without a management plan makes any aggressive optimisation strategy riskier. Missing even one marker means treating one part of a four-part system — and getting incomplete results.

Frequently Asked Questions
What blood tests should a 55-year-old man get for sexual health?
At minimum, a men’s health blood panel at 55 should include total testosterone, free testosterone, estradiol (E2), PSA, and hematocrit. These four markers work together to reveal hormonal balance, prostate health, and circulation — the three pillars that determine sexual performance and energy. A basic testosterone test alone won’t give you the full picture.
What’s the difference between total and free testosterone?
Total testosterone measures all testosterone in your blood, including the portion bound to proteins like SHBG. Free testosterone is the small, unbound fraction your cells can actually use. You can have normal total testosterone but low free testosterone — and still experience symptoms like erectile dysfunction, fatigue, and low libido. Free testosterone is generally the more clinically relevant marker.
Why do men need to test estradiol (estrogen)?
Estradiol is a form of estrogen that men produce naturally through the conversion of testosterone. It’s essential for libido, bone density, mood, and erectile function. Both too little and too much estradiol can impair erections and drive. It’s particularly important to monitor estradiol if you’re on testosterone therapy, as elevated aromatase activity can push levels too high.
How does hematocrit affect erectile dysfunction?
Hematocrit measures blood thickness. When testosterone stimulates excessive red blood cell production — which can happen on TRT — blood becomes thicker, increasing pressure and reducing the quality of circulation to the penile tissue. This can worsen erections even when testosterone levels are well-optimised. Routine monitoring helps prevent this and supports the vascular function that healthy erections rely on.
Should I have a PSA test even if I have no prostate symptoms?
Yes. Doctors widely recommend PSA screening from age 55 (or earlier with a family history) as a baseline for prostate health monitoring. The goal isn’t to find a “low” number — it’s to establish your personal baseline so that any future rise can be detected early and investigated appropriately. This is particularly important if you’re considering testosterone optimisation, as testosterone can stimulate prostate tissue.
Can these blood markers be improved without medication?
In many cases, yes — at least partially. Lifestyle factors including resistance training, quality sleep, reducing alcohol intake, managing body fat, and reducing chronic stress all have meaningful impacts on testosterone, estradiol balance, and hematocrit. However, significant hormonal imbalances typically require clinical guidance.
